Item Description

A wonderful small cabinet display specimen of the classic Uchuccchacua Rhodochrosites. These are easily the most recognizable Rhodos from any Peruvian (or even South American) locality. The combination of the fiery color of the crystals and excellent gemminess with that classic scalenohedral form make them incredibly desirable. Here we have a very attractive small cabinet piece featuring excellent, very sharp, well-formed, highly lustrous, gemmy, glowing pinkish-red colored modified scalenohedral crystals measuring up to 1.4 cm with a bit of associated Quartz sitting on matrix. The main Rhodos are in excellent condition but there are some contacted areas where the piece was removed from the pocket wall. A very attractive and fine quality example of this classic material from Peru. Ex Brian Kosnar Collection.
